Abstract

fetched live from OpenAlex

Study of the guided waves in piezoelectric cylinders based on a semi-analytical finite element method is presented. In the study, the dispersion equation was formulated as a generalized eigenvalue problem by treating mechanical displacements and electric potential with one dimensional quadratic finite element model through the thickness of the cylinder. Here the general eigenvalue problem is depended on three parameters, namely, the frequency, the axial wave number and the circumferential wave. A non-integer circumferential wave is introduced here for studying the guided spiral wave. A wave spectrum surface is generated to incorporate the guided spiral waves. Cylinders having different geometry and electric boundary conditions are studied but only the results for a thin cylinder with closed electric boundary conditions are presented.
